Zappos

Zappos is an uk online shoe shopping websites retailer that is known as being one of the most focused on its customers. They have a distinct culture and are always looking for new ways to improve their business. They even open their headquarters in Las Vegas to the public to let people know how they operate. Investors are also watching Zappos as well as Sequoia Ventures - a major venture capitalist in the United States.

They also have a generous returns policy. If you buy shoes from them and they're not what you expected or don't match your expectations they will let you return them for a full year. This is something that most online stores don't do. This makes customers feel a more relaxed shopping experience and helps to build confidence.

Zappos makes it easy for their customers to contact them with any questions or concerns. While most companies hide their contact information five links deep, Zappos puts it on every page and staffs their telephone line 24 hours a day. Zappos has also developed an merchandising plan that allows them to sell cross-sells and upsells on products. This helps increase average order values and create more revenue for the business.

Zappos earns money by selling online shoes, clothing, and accessories. They also sell merchandise through their discount division, 6PM. They have a variety of high-end shoes, such as Adidas, Nike, UGG, The North Face, and Tory Burch. Their success is due in large part to their top-quality products and outstanding service.

Bloomingdale's

Bloomingdale's is a luxury department store that has more than 100 years of history. The store offers a wide range of clothes and accessories from high-end brands. The store offers many options, including free WiFi and multilingual support for non-English customers. It also has a large variety of dining options. The store is a great place to spend your day shopping and enjoying delicious food.

The first Bloomingdale's was opened in New York City, in 1861. The company was established by the brothers Lyman and Samuel Bloomingdale. They offered a wide range of products, from women's stockings, to wool suits and upright pianos. By 1929 the department store was growing and became one of the city's most popular. In 1930 it merged with Federated Department Stores, which was later acquired by Macy's, Inc.

In recent years the company has changed its focus to more modern and contemporary design. The rebranding includes updated logos and a focus on customer service. The brand has also focused on offering a greater variety of products, such as home goods and cosmetics.

The store also offers a variety of jewelry and beauty products. Cosmetics include makeup by CREED, Maison Francis Kurkdijan and Sisley-Paris. The store also sells perfumes, bags, and other accessories. It even has a wedding registry and offers gift cards for any occasion.

Nasty Gal

Nasty Gal caters to fashionistas in their 20s. Its trendy style has gained it a cult status among its target market. The brand has a range of on-trend pieces for everything from an evening out with the girls to outfits for music festivals. They also offer a variety of accessories and dresses that look expensive but aren't expensive.

The company was established in 2006 by Sophia Amoruso. She began selling vintage clothes on eBay however, the popularity of her store inspired her to move out of her aunt's home to an even bigger warehouse in Berkeley. The company grew rapidly and was recognized for its quirky style.

Nasty Gal, now owned by Boohoo has expanded its offering to include shoes and accessories. The website offers a large selection of looks including linen, knit and denim pieces. The brand also has various bodycon dresses and blazers.

Despite its popularity, Nasty Gal has had problems in the past. The company's rapid growth was driven by a large amount of money spent on marketing and advertising, which can be an effective strategy, but it can also destroy a company if it doesn't result in loyal customers. It has also struggled with debt, and strained relationships between vendors. These issues contributed to its bankruptcy filing last year. Nasty gal has also been affected by a lack of diversity in its workforce.

Urban Outfitters

Urban Outfitters is a popular fashion retailer known for its stylish designs and diverse range of merchandise. Many customers have sought alternatives due to the company's low sustainability rating and questionable work practices. Additionally the use of non-organic cotton as well as an absence of transparency about its supply chain has led to an increase in scrutiny of the brand.

The company's customer satisfaction is evident in its Net Promoter Score, which determines how likely consumers are to recommend the product to friends and family. The score for the company is 18 which includes 45percent Promoters and 28 percent of passives. The score is calculated based on simple questions asking customers if they would recommend the service or product.

Urban Outfitters offers a variety of boutique labels, brands and accessories for women and men. They also sell kitschy accessories and homewares that appeal to all age groups. The Womenswear collection features top-of-the-line diffusion labels like See By Chloe and Anglomania. Paul Joe Sister and Tatty Devine are also available. The Menswear Collection features small-scale brands like Lyle Scott G Star Fred Perry and Nike.

The retailer is also well-known for its unique style that has gained a lot of attention among students and young adults. The company has made efforts to incorporate eco-friendly products into its collections, however there is a lot of scope to improve its environmental impact and labor practices. Customers looking for sustainable alternatives to Urban Outfitters can look for companies who prioritize environmentally friendly manufacturing practices and fair working conditions.

The Frankie Shop

Since its debut on the scene in 2014 The Frankie Shop is a favorite among fashion bloggers and social media celebrities. Gaelle Drevet founded the boutique to provide women with the belief that "looking nice doesn't have to be perfect". The brand has earned a cult following among fashion-conscious women and style-conscious consumers, thanks to its Bea suits and eco-friendly clothing becoming staples of closets around the world. The brand has also enthused celebrities' attention, including Gigi Hadid and trusted online shopping sites for clothes Hailey Bieber, and is carried at luxury department stores including Net-a-Porter and Farfetch.

The large tops, dresses, and blazers are designed to be worn all day. The slouchy cut adds a dash of sophistication. The collection of the label are inspired by Paris and New York are a sophisticated feminine take on minimalist design. The label has been able to establish a loyal following among celebrities who frequently post their Frankie Shop purchase with the hashtag #frankiegirl.

The Frankie Shop is a multi-brand retailer which has been successful in a time of difficulty. This is due to the fact that it has its inventory carefully curated. The limited inventory allows the company to test market trends and improve the appeal of its products. This strategy has been successful for the brand, as its products consistently sell out and are replenished within a matter of days. The Frankie Shop is set to expand its operations this year, with new locations in both New York and Paris.
